Facile One-pot Protocol of Derivatization Nitropyridines: Access to 3-Acetamidopyridin-2-yl 4-methylbenzenesulfonate Derivatives
Heterocyclic Communications ( IF 1.3 ) Pub Date : 2019-12-19 , DOI: 10.1515/hc-2019-0017
Ling Lin 1 , Xiaoguang Chen 1 , Junhao Zhao 1 , Suitao Lin 1 , Guojian Ma 1 , Xiaojian Liao 1 , Pengju Feng 1
Affiliation  

Abstract This paper discloses an efficient one-pot protocol to convert easily accessible 3-nitropyridines to 3-acetamidopyridin-2-yl 4-methylbenzenesulfonate derivatives which are core structures of many pharmaceutical molecules. The strategy successfully combined a three-step reaction in one pot via progressively adding different reactants at rt. The reaction displays good functional group tolerance and regioselectivity. Structurally diversified 3-nitropyridine could be time-efficiently (3.5 h) derivatized to various functional 2-O,3-N-pyridines which are apt for further elaborations. The transformation was amenable to gram-scale synthesis.
